Job Description

What will the role involve?

You will write and develop stories, with great pictures and engaging video. You will deliver a fast turnaround on major news stories across Ireland, the UK and around the world and bring in exclusive stories that set us apart from our rivals. All while ensuring that every piece of content is researched and published in accordance with the Press Council's Code of Practice. You will be confident using a range of digital formats and quickly identify breaking news by utilising social media.

Please note this job will also require some acting up and covering on the Newsdesk when required, therefore experience of this is desirable.

Qualifications

Who are we looking for?

An experienced journalist with your relevant journalism degree and media law knowledge (we will consider candidates with relevant time served), you have a strong track record of delivering a wide range of engaging human interest and hard hitting stories at a national or major regional title while understanding what works for a digital audience.

You have first rate editing, writing and subbing skills, relish the test of working under pressure and to tight deadlines. You’re social media savvy with current SEO knowledge and ideally you're familiar with newsroom analytics and content management systems.
